Types of Field Sobriety Tests Used in Drug Evaluations

Several field sobriety tests are used by law enforcement in drug evaluations to assess impairment. These tests aim to detect cognitive and motor function deficits associated with drug use. Commonly employed assessments include the Horizontal Gaze Nystagmus (HGN) test, Walk-and-Turn, and One-Leg Stand.

The HGN test evaluates involuntary eye movements that can be exaggerated by CNS depressants or stimulants. This test is often considered one of the more reliable indicators of impairment when conducted properly. The Walk-and-Turn test assesses balance, attention, and ability to follow instructions, while the One-Leg Stand measures balance and coordination.

While these tests are standard in field sobriety evaluations, their validity in drug cases remains debated. Variations in individual physical conditions and environmental factors can influence outcomes, underscoring the importance of proper training and protocol adherence for law enforcement personnel.

Challenges in Assessing Drug Impairment Through Field Tests

Assessing drug impairment through field sobriety tests presents several notable challenges. One primary issue is the subjectivity inherent in these evaluations, which can vary significantly among law enforcement officers. Factors such as personal experience, training, and perceptions influence the judgment, potentially impacting reliability.

Additionally, physical limitations or medical conditions of individuals may affect their performance independently of drug impairment. Conditions like fatigue, anxiety, or neurological disorders can mimic or mask impairment signs, complicating accurate assessment. This variability weakens the overall validity of field tests in drug cases.

Another significant challenge involves the presence of legal or environmental factors. Unfavorable conditions such as poor lighting, weather, or uneven surfaces can interfere with test performance. These external factors may lead to false positives or negatives, further questioning the validity of field sobriety tests in drug evaluations.

Overall, these challenges highlight the difficulty of relying solely on field tests for drug impairment assessment, underscoring the importance of supplementary evidence like toxicology reports for a comprehensive evaluation.

Toxicologists and Drug Recognition Experts’ Perspectives

Toxicologists and Drug Recognition Experts often have differing perspectives on the validity of field sobriety tests in drug cases. Toxicologists emphasize the importance of chemical analysis, such as blood or urine tests, as the most reliable indicators of impairment. They argue that field sobriety tests alone are insufficient to determine the presence and extent of drug influence due to their subjective nature.

Drug Recognition Experts (DREs), on the other hand, rely on observational assessments during field tests, including physiological and behavioral indicators. They contend that well-trained experts can identify drug impairment through these tests, which provide immediate insights. However, they acknowledge limitations in the standardization and scientific validation of these assessments.

Both groups agree that the validity of field sobriety tests in drug cases is complex. While DREs may assist in rapid evaluation, toxicity analyses remain the gold standard for establishing impairment. The perspectives of toxicologists and drug recognition experts are integral to understanding the strengths and weaknesses of field sobriety tests in legal proceedings.

When Toxicology Results Supersede Field Observations

Toxicology results generally carry more weight than field observations in legal proceedings involving drug impairment. Laboratory-based chemical testing directly measures specific substances in a person’s blood or urine, providing objective evidence of drug presence and concentration.

While field sobriety tests are designed to detect signs of impairment, they are subject to human error, environmental factors, and individual differences. Conversely, toxicology reports offer quantifiable data that can corroborate or challenge initial field assessments.

In many cases, courts tend to prioritize toxicology results because they establish a clear, scientific basis for drug impairment, reducing reliance on subjective judgments. When discrepancies exist between field observations and laboratory findings, the latter often determine the final legal ruling regarding impairment.

However, it is important to note that toxicology results may have limitations, such as the time delay between impairment and testing or individual variations in drug metabolism. Nevertheless, when available, they typically play a decisive role in assessing drug impairment in legal cases.
